A Little Boy Once Dreamt

A little boy once dreamt:
houses made of chocolate,
and the skies low enough to reach.
The chocolate hard, once melted in its liquid,
ready for our dry lips to taste.
The skies low, to see what's beyond us,
mars covered in candy, a beautiful atmosphere, everlasting.

And the little boy also dreamt,
life without pain,
and the world to love and like -
no beings muddleheaded,
no dying without reason,
no opprobrious souls...
a life for each and every one of us to live peacefully,
hand in hand.
